The board of Consecutive Investments & Trading Company, at its meeting on May 29, 2025, approved audited financial results for the quarter and year ended March 31, 2025. Revenue from operations jumped sharply to Rs. 2,260.09 lakhs for the full year FY25, up from nil in FY24. Net profit for FY25 stood at Rs. 223.13 lakhs (vs Rs. 16.79 lakhs in FY24), with EPS of Rs. 0.14. Q4 FY25 PAT was Rs. 55.44 lakhs versus Rs. 8.67 lakhs a year earlier. The auditor (S K Bhavsar & Co.) issued an unmodified opinion but flagged an Emphasis of Matter regarding unverifiable balances in trade receivables, inventories, and trade payables, with physical inventory not verified by the auditor. The company also confirmed it does not qualify as a 'Large Corporate' under SEBI's debt circular, with borrowings of only Rs. 0.06 crore.
Strong topline and bottomline growth year-on-year, but the auditor's emphasis of matter on unreconciled receivables, inventories, and payables raises red flags about earnings quality. Operating cash flow turned negative despite reported profits, suggesting working capital pressures that investors should watch closely.
